Xiaomi just announced a new addition to its Mi flagship series in the Chinese market packing the latest Snapdragon 855 SoC, triple cameras, and 20W wireless charging. At the same event, the Chinese phone maker also confirmed that the handset will come with the Snapdragon X50 modem with 5G network support. The company also introduced a cheaper model of the phone under the name of Xiaomi Mi 9 SE. The more affordable Xiaomi Mi model will be priced at 1,999 CNY (around Rs. 21,100). It will still feature an on-screen fingerprint scanner and a 48MP main sensor on the rear.

Xiaomi Mi 9 SE: Specifications & Features
The phone sports a 5.97-inch Full-HD+ AMOLED panel and it will be powered by a Snapdragon 712 chipset instead of the top-of-the-line Snapdragon 855 SoC on the standard Xiaomi Mi 9. It also packs 6GB RAM and either 64GB or 128GB of storage. To keep the phone ticking, there is a 3,070mAh battery under the hood, while it is a 3,500mAh battery on the standard model

The more affordable Mi 9 SEhas support 18W fast charging and it sports a triple camera setup on the back as well. The setup comprises of a 48MP mains sensor, an 8MP secondary sensor, and a 13MP third sensor. Beside the Mi 9 SE, the Chinese company also announced a special edition of the Mi 9 which is called Mi 9 Transparent Edition, which will come with a transparent back. The Xiaomi Mi 9 Transparent Edition will have support for up to 40W fast charging and pack a whopping 12GB RAM/256GB of storage.

Xiaomi Mi 9 SE: Price & Availability

The Xiaomi Mi 9 SE is priced at CNY 1,999 (around Rs. 21,100) for the 6GB RAM/64GB storage, and CNY 2,299 (around Rs. 24,300) for the model with 6GB RAM/128GB storage.

Meanwhile, the Xiaomi Mi 9 Transparent Edition variant with 12GB of RAM/256GB of internal storage is priced at CNY 3,999 (around Rs. 42,300).
All of the three editions will be available for pre-ordering from 6 pm today, while the sales will begin from 10 am on 26 February via Xiaomi’s website and other e-commerce platforms such as Suning, Tmall, JD.com and more.
